IN LOVING MEMORY OF
David A.
Beaulieu
August 2, 1965 – January 28, 2017
David A. Beaulieu, 51, of Salem, MA passed away on Saturday, January 28, 2017 after a long illness surrounded by his loving family. He was married to Rosanna (Sanchez) Beaulieu with whom he celebrated their 1 st wedding anniversary.
Born and raised in Lowell, MA, he was a graduate of Lowell High School Class of 1984. He moved to Salem when he married his "Rosie" in August 2015.
Dave was a Nuisance Wildlife expert for over 25 years, one of the leaders in the industry. At the time of his passing, he was employed by Pest End Exterminators.
Dave loved golfing, camping, sports, concerts and travel. His greatest enjoyment was spending time with family and friends. His legacy is his passion for life that will live in all those he touched with his infectious smile and contagious laugh.
